Abstract
We investigate behaviors of vehicles passing a work zone on two-lane highway. The traffic flow mathematical model is formulated based on optimal velocity model and safe lane-changing rules for two-lane traffic flow are given. The typical sketch of work zone is plotted and four posted speed limit signs are set in the work zone to control the traffic flow speed for fear of accident and congestion. Simulations are carried out to examine the lane-changing behavior and the influence on traffic flow in work zone with different number of the speed limit signs under periodic boundary conditions. The simulations show that lane-changing may lead to the congestion or collision while the more speed limit signs may reduce the risk of rear-end collision and the occurrence of the congestion in work zone.
